D48.118 — Desmoid tumor of other site
D48.118 is a billable, specific ICD-10-CM code for desmoid tumor of other site. It is valid for submission on a claim.
Risk adjustment
D48.118 does not map to an HCC and does not risk-adjust under CMS-HCC V28. That is normal — most ICD-10 codes do not. It still needs to be coded correctly; it just will not move a RAF score.

Related codes at this level
Codes that share D48.11. If D48.118 is not quite right, the correct code is usually one of these.
- D48.110Desmoid tumor of head and neck
- D48.111Desmoid tumor of chest wall
- D48.112Desmoid tumor, intrathoracic
- D48.113Desmoid tumor of abdominal wall
- D48.114Desmoid tumor, intraabdominal
- D48.115Desmoid tumor of upper extremity and shoulder girdle
- D48.116Desmoid tumor of lower extremity and pelvic girdle
- D48.117Desmoid tumor of back
- D48.119Desmoid tumor of unspecified site
